Roma Tre University has been engaged for several years both to reduce the use of plastic and to raise awareness within its academic community through the campaign “Roma3noplastic” which aims to act upstream of the plastic pollution problem. Roma Tre has purchased 36.000 stainless steel thermal bottles with the Roma Tre logo and during 2024 were delivered to students and to staff free of charge the last 550 bottles of the supply. Another supply of over 20.000 bottles is planned for the year 2025.
To further discourage the use of single-use plastic bottles, the University provided drinking water dispensers for students and staff. There are 28 water dispensers throughout all University campuses and thanks to these, 787463 Liters of water were dispensed in 2024. This resulted in a saving of 1.500.000 plastic bottles corresponding to approximately 25 tons of plastic not introduced in the environment and allowed a saving of about 42,5 tons of Co2.
